The sixth edition of this book covers the key topics in computer organization an embedded systems. it presents hardware design principles and shows how hardware design is influenced by the requirements of software. the book is suitable for undergraduate electrical and computer engineering majors and computer science specialist. it is intended for a first course in computer organization and embedded systems. the book features a balances approach to all aspects of modern computer design-processor, input/output, memory and interconnection standards. the focus is on the design of complete systems, both general-purpose computres and embedded systems. the book is self-contained. it is intended primarily for students who have already had a course in the design of logic circuits. for students without such a background, a comprehensive appendix on logic circuits is included
